Block a user
Define what should be available for run-time configuration.
Select ethernet communication protocol
Add proper data selection to RAM module
Create rust driver for amlib UART device
Evaluate and create wishbone interface for amlib UART device.
Export some amount of versioning information in SoC
Create infrastructure to auto-generate register documentation.
Create rust driver for amlib I2C interface.
Evaluate and create wishbone interface for amlib I2C device.